1. The Scourge of Fentanyl: A Public Health Emergency

Fentanyl Pills

Fentanyl, a synthetic opioid 50 to 100 times more potent than morphine, has emerged as a deadly menace in the drug landscape. Its illicit manufacturing and distribution have fueled a staggering rise in overdose deaths across the United States. The Drug Enforcement Administration (DEA) has classified fentanyl as a Schedule II controlled substance, highlighting its high potential for abuse and severe dependence.

4. The Dark Web's Nefarious Marketplace: A Breeding Ground for Illicit Trade

Dark Web Marketplace, Fentanyl

The dark web, a hidden segment of the internet accessible only through specialized software, has become a haven for illicit activities, including the sale of fentanyl. Buyers and sellers exploit the anonymity and lack of regulation on the dark web to engage in illegal transactions. The anonymity provided by cryptocurrencies further obscures the identities of those involved, making it challenging for law enforcement agencies to track and prosecute offenders.

6. A Glimmer of Hope: Promising Developments in Cryptocurrency Regulation

Cryptocurrency Regulation Initiatives

While the cryptocurrency industry faces criticism for its role in facilitating fentanyl transactions, it's important to acknowledge positive developments in cryptocurrency regulation. Several countries, including the United States, have taken steps to implement stricter regulations aimed at curbing illicit activities. These initiatives include Know Your Customer (KYC) and Anti-Money Laundering (AML) requirements, which help identify and prevent suspicious transactions.

7. The Blockchain's Potential: A Tool for Transparency and Accountability

Blockchain Technology, Transparent Transactions

Despite the challenges, blockchain technology, the underlying technology behind cryptocurrencies, holds immense potential in combating illicit activities. The transparent and immutable nature of blockchain transactions can aid law enforcement agencies in tracking and tracing illegal transactions. Additionally, blockchain-based initiatives can provide real-time monitoring and flagging of suspicious transactions, enabling swift action by authorities.
